Humans are a bundle of many things. Physically, we are a bundle of water; psychically, we are a bundle of emotions. Sure, there are many other things, but emotions are a major part of what we are. Emotions make people cry - I cry, though rarely - they make people laugh, people smile and frown. They make some people overjoyed, and other people so miserable that they kill themselves. Yes, emotions are a very powerful thing, and a dangerous thing to hide. The human is full of them, they control every aspect of his life, whether he tries to let them or not.

Emotions are a mental state that arise spontaneously and is often accompanied by psychological changes; a feeling -joy, sorrow, hate and love. Where there is life there are emotions. Non living things like machines do not possess emotions. It is the emotions that differentiates a living being from the non livings.

Man is said to be the bundle of emotions. In fact it is the emotions that make a man a living being. All the human activities are guided by his emotions. It is the degree of emotions that differentiates a man from other animals. Though other animals do have emotions but of short horizon.

As quoted by famous philosopher Aristotle, man is a social animal. Society comes into existence because of interpersonal relations of human being which are controlled by emotions. We cannot expect a society without existence of emotions among its members. Even the existing societies will come to an end in the absence of emotions.

It is emotions that create a bond of attachment among human being. Unlike machines the human beings love, hate, weep, laugh, feels jealous, pride etc. It is because of emotions that a man is treated differently than machines. He is paid, mostly employed locally, provided leave etc for recreation and to meet family need i.e. emotions. Even Mash-low has also described the role of emotions in human needs.

If we look at life it is nothing but survival of emotions. We earn livelihood working in different professions. My friends may argue that at work place, specially today, man keeps the emotions away and behaves like a machine. A manager never thinks of emotions but of output. But let us think why at all a man works! He works to fulfill not only his personal needs but also that of his family and society. Here the emotions come into picture. Though at work place he may avoid showing emotions, but his ultimate aim of working is the emotions. Though one may not show emotions at work place, it still prevails within him. It can be seen when one of his friends falls sick, immediately emotions come into picture and he starts taking care of his friend leaving the work aside.

The role of emotions is found continuously in human life. Be it the attachment between mother and child or a father taking care of his children and vice versa at a later stage of life or be it a school teacher bothering for the students or be it any other relations, all are based on emotional attachment. It is the emotional attachment that makes a father feel pride when his child stands first in the class. It is only and only emotional attachment that makes us shadow tears when some of our near one passes away.

It may be argued that emotions alone will not lead the humanity to the world of development of science and technology. Correct, but what the thought of development is based upon- definitely on human needs which is based on emotions. At the same time it may be remembered that the development without association of emotions proves destructive. The world has seen it at many occasions. The world has seen the use of atomic energy both in peaceful construction i.e. development and in destruction Eg JAPAN. It is only emotional attachments that insists for the correct use of inventions. Therefore the need for association of emotions.

If we see the reel life i.e. cinema industry, which projects the real life, the role of emotions become more clear. The whole movie moves along with human emotions. At times, Even a movie watcher starts weeping, laughing, he become angry etc. what does it show- definitely role of emotions in human life.

To conclude, we can say it is the emotions that make the man ‘a living object’. At the most one can suppress emotions for time being, but one can never and in no way, separate emotions from human life. Therefore it can be said that ‘HUMAN IS A BUNDLE OF EMOTIONS’.
